With the rapid development of the food industry, chemical pollution has gradually become a prominent issue, posing a signifcant challenge in the feld of food engineering. This paper explores the main sources of chemical contamination in food engineering and its impact on food safety, and proposes targeted control measures. By strengthening the formulation and enforcement of laws and regulations, promoting green agriculture and environmentally friendly production technologies, optimizing the use and management of food additives, and enhancing the environmental protection and safety of packaging materials, chemical pollution in food engineering can be effectively controlled to ensure food safety and public health. The implementation of these measures not only contributes to the sustainable development of the food industry but also enhances consumer confdence in food safety.
